Abstract
The and peaks recently discovered in photoproduction are interpreted as charmed antibaryons. Specifically it is suggested that the is the charmed analog of and decays weakly. Quantum-number and spin-parity assignments are discussed briefly. We give isospin relations and predictions for the mean multiplicity of nonleptonic decay products, with special attention to channels detectable in existing experiments. A strategy for studying the dynamics of multibody nonleptonic decays is outlined and an interesting soft-pion theorem is recalled. Semileptonic decays are mentioned in passing. The is interpreted as an amalgam of the charmed analogs of and ; the shape of its two-peak structure is deduced. Prospects for the observation of additional charmed baryons are considered.
